Dr. Stephen L. Anderson, MD

300 Pasteur Dr Ste R-159, Stanford, CA 94305

Matthew P. Burke

300 Pasteur Dr, Stanford, CA 94305

Dr. Stephen L. Anderson, MD

300 Pasteur Dr Ste R-159, Stanford, CA 94305

Matthew P. Burke

300 Pasteur Dr, Stanford, CA 94305

Doctor Directory | TOS | twitter | FB | Angel | blog